**What are your contributions to the team?**
The Control Laws/Stability and Control (Claws/S&C) team is responsible for ensuring appropriate aircraft flight characteristics. Key activities include designing/developing and testing Fly-by-Wire (FBW) flight control laws for the next generation Bombardier Aircrafts. Moreover, the team contributes to the development of new or derivative aircraft (including missionized aircraft) and supports continued airworthiness of in-service aircraft. The team also actively participates in flight testing activities and closely interacts with regulatory authorities to ensure safety and compliance to airworthiness requirements.
+ Assess stability and control characteristics of aircraft
+ Prepare and support wind tunnel
+ Plan and support flight test and simulation followed by required analyses and documentation
+ Analyze and process simulation and flight test data
+ Plan and conduct desktop or pilot-in-the-loop simulations to assess the aircraft handling qualities due to design and/or model changes, for certification, or problem investigations with potential improvements
+ Write and review reports which demonstrate flight characteristic compliance with airworthiness regulations
+ Provide support to aircraft production and in-flight qualification for aerodynamics and aircraft handling related issues and non-conformities
+ Support the development and modification to flight simulation models
+ Define high level aircraft design requirements (handling qualities, sensors, actuators etc.)
